5. Capybara Conservation: Protecting These Endangered Animals

The gentle and sociable capybara is the world's largest rodent, inhabiting wetlands and grasslands throughout South America. Unfortunately, these fascinating creatures face a number of threats, including habitat loss, hunting for their meat and fur, and competition with livestock. Conservation efforts are crucial to protecting this precious species.

These initiatives involve establishing protected areas, raising awareness about the importance of capybaras in their ecosystems, and working with local communities to promote sustainable land use practices.
